Easy hiking trails around Linau, located in Schleswig-Holstein, Germany, are characterized by gentle terrain, extensive woodlands, and riverine landscapes. The region features the Hahnheide forest, offering a network of paths suitable for relaxed walks. Hikers can explore routes that follow the Bille river and traverse open fields, providing varied natural scenery. The area's low elevation changes make it ideal for accessible outdoor activities.

In 1230, the Slavic settlement was first mentioned in the Ratzeburg tithe register as Linowe or Lynowe. The place name goes back to Old Polabian *Linov and is a combination of *lin "tench" and the possessive suffix -ov and means settlement near the tench. Linau is of Slavic origin and lies on the "Limes Saxoniae", the former border between Saxons and Slavs, which enters the administrative area here. According to historical research, it can be assumed that the then "Lynowe" existed as a settlement much earlier. Linau Castle was destroyed in 1291, and the second castle in 1349. The remains of the castle complex are now more clearly visible again, as the foundation of the complex was restored as authentically as possible in a very complex operation in cooperation with the State Archaeological Office. The complex thus gives visitors an idea of its former importance. It is the only castle ruin of its kind in southern Holstein. Linau is located on the edge of the Hahnheide nature reserve and local recreation area, directly on the district border with Stormarn. The community had 543 inhabitants in 1939. After the unspeakable war, there were 1031. Many of them have accepted the community as their new home. Linau has an intact, diverse club life, including a motivated volunteer fire department. This is not least and especially due to the initiative of the Linauers. https://gemeinde-linau.de/unser-dorf/ https://de.wikipedia.org/wiki/Linau

February 8, 2025, War Memorial Linau

A lot of asphalt surrounds the well-kept small complex for the dead soldiers of both world wars. The relatively young tree, probably a linden tree, has an unusual location; it stands in the middle of the path to the memorial stone. The complex is surrounded on three sides by strong, dark wooden posts, which are connected by an iron chain. You enter the complex through a double-winged galvanized gate. The path is paved with "cat's head" stones, it splits in front of the tree and leads around it. The roots of the tree lift the stones irregularly. The curved retaining wall of the raised, densely planted area stretches across the entire width of the property. The path paving widens up to the retaining wall, which was assembled from boulders and field stones of different sizes and connected with mortar. The central memorial stone is a well-formed, light-colored, almost triangular boulder. A large Iron Cross was carved in outline at the top and painted black. The military badge of honor is awarded posthumously to soldiers here in Linau. A cast-iron plate was set into the stone below. The inscription in the wide frame reads: To our fallen 1914 – 1918 1939 – 1945 The years of the world wars are decorated with crossed oak branches with acorns. The plaque was made after 1945, the years of World War II are not an addition to the old plate for World War I. The names of the dead soldiers are recorded on the war memorial in Sandesneben. The war memorial is illuminated in the dark. The gate is richly decorated. The struts are decorated with different patterns and curved double hearts. The coat of arms of Linau was attached to the wider wing. https://www.denk-mal-gegen-krieg.de/kriegerdenkmaeler/schleswig-holstein-l/

Frequently Asked Questions

How many easy hiking trails are available in Linau?

Linau offers a good selection of easy hiking trails, with over 20 routes specifically categorized as easy. In total, there are 35 hiking tours in the area, providing plenty of options for relaxed walks.

What kind of terrain can I expect on easy hikes around Linau?

Easy hikes around Linau are characterized by gentle terrain with minimal elevation changes. You'll primarily find extensive woodlands, especially within the Hahnheide forest, and pleasant riverine landscapes along the Bille river. The paths are generally well-suited for accessible outdoor activities.

Are there any circular routes among the easy hikes in Linau?

Yes, many of the easy hikes in Linau are circular routes, perfect for starting and ending at the same point. For example, the Descent from the Hahnheide Tower – Siebenstern Bank loop from Linau and the Hiking loop from Linau are popular options that allow you to explore the area without retracing your steps.

What are some family-friendly easy hikes in Linau?

The easy trails in Linau, with their gentle terrain and woodland settings, are generally very family-friendly. Routes like the Bridge Over the Bille loop from Linau offer pleasant walks through nature that are suitable for all ages. The Hahnheide forest also provides a safe and engaging environment for families to explore.

Can I bring my dog on the easy hiking trails in Linau?

Most easy hiking trails in Linau, particularly those through the Hahnheide forest and along the Bille river, are dog-friendly. It's always a good idea to keep your dog on a leash, especially in nature reserves or areas with wildlife, and to respect local regulations.

Are there any viewpoints or interesting landmarks to see on easy hikes in Linau?

Yes, several easy hikes offer access to interesting sights. The Descent from the Hahnheide Tower – Siebenstern Bank loop from Linau provides views from the Hahnheide Tower. You can also find the Langer Otto Observation Tower (Hahnheide Conservation Area), which offers panoramic views of the surrounding forest and landscape.

What do other hikers say about the easy trails in Linau?

The easy trails in Linau are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.3 stars from over 140 reviews. Hikers often praise the quiet woodlands, well-maintained paths, and the tranquil experience offered by routes through the Hahnheide forest and along the Bille river.

Is there parking available near the easy hiking trails in Linau?

Yes, parking is generally available at common starting points for hiking trails in and around Linau, especially near popular access points to the Hahnheide forest. Specific parking information can often be found on individual route descriptions on komoot.

When is the best time of year to go hiking in Linau?

Linau's easy hiking trails are enjoyable year-round. Spring brings fresh greenery and blooming flora, summer offers pleasant warmth for woodland walks, autumn showcases beautiful fall colors, and even winter can be charming with crisp air and potential snow. The gentle terrain makes it accessible in most conditions.

Are there any short, easy hikes suitable for a quick outing in Linau?

Absolutely. For a quick and easy outing, consider routes like the Bench at Ulrich Meyer Platz – Owl Sculpture Waymarker loop from Linau, which is just over 3.5 km long and can be completed in about an hour. These shorter loops are perfect for a refreshing walk without committing to a longer trek.

What makes the Hahnheide forest a good place for easy hiking?

The Hahnheide forest is ideal for easy hiking due to its extensive network of well-maintained paths, gentle elevation changes, and diverse natural scenery. It offers a peaceful environment with lush woodlands, making it perfect for relaxed walks and enjoying nature without strenuous climbs.

Are there any easy trails that follow the Bille river?

Yes, Linau features easy trails that traverse riverine landscapes, including those along the Bille river. The Bridge Over the Bille loop from Linau is a prime example, offering a pleasant walk alongside the river, often completed in about 1 hour 20 minutes.

What are the general characteristics of easy hikes in Linau for beginners?

Beginners will find Linau's easy hikes very welcoming. They typically feature flat or gently rolling paths, are well-marked, and require no special equipment beyond comfortable walking shoes. The focus is on enjoying the natural surroundings, such as the Hahnheide forest and the Bille river, at a relaxed pace.
